Is it possible to add a CM4 to CM3 model in the future?

The CM3 and CM4 do not use the same connection at all. You can’t connect a CM4 without an adapter that is most likely to not fit in a DevTerm. So to put a CM4 they would need to make a new base board just for the CM4, so it is mostly unlikely.
